PSLE Linda saved $660 in August. This amount was a 10% increase from what she saved in July. The amount she saved in September was a 50% decrease from what she saved in August.
- What was the total amount that Linda saved from July to September?
- What was the percentage decrease in the amount Linda saved in September compared to July?

(a)
Savings in July = 100%
Savings in August = 100% + 10% = 110%
110% = 660
1% = 660 ÷ 110 = 6
Savings in July
= 100%
= 100 x 6
= $600
Savings in August = 100 u
Savings in September = 100 u - 50 u = 50 u
100 u = 660
1 u = 660 ÷ 100 = 6.6
Savings in September
= 50 u
= 50 x 6.6
= $330
Total savings from July to September
= 600 + 660 + 330
= $1590
(b)
Decrease in savings in September compared to July
= 600 - 330
= $270
Percentage decrease

= 45%
Answer(s): (a) $1590; (b) 45%
